Backflow preventer installation services involve the setup of specialized devices designed to protect potable water supplies from contamination caused by reverse flow. These devices are typically installed at strategic points within a property's plumbing system to ensure that non-potable water, such as from irrigation systems or industrial processes, does not flow back into the clean water supply. The installation process requires careful assessment of the property's plumbing layout, followed by the proper placement and connection of the backflow preventer to ensure it functions correctly and adheres to local plumbing codes and standards.
This service helps address common issues related to backflow incidents, which can introduce pollutants, bacteria, or chemicals into drinking water supplies. Such problems often arise from pressure changes within the plumbing system, cross-connections, or system malfunctions, especially during periods of high demand or emergencies. Installing a backflow preventer provides a reliable safeguard against these risks, helping property owners maintain safe and clean water for everyday use, whether in residential, commercial, or industrial settings.
Backflow preventer installation services are frequently sought after by a variety of property types. Residential properties, particularly those with irrigation systems, swimming pools, or wells, benefit from these devices to prevent contamination of household water supplies. Commercial properties, such as restaurants, offices, and retail buildings, often require backflow preventers to comply with health regulations and ensure safe water for employees and customers. Additionally, industrial facilities with complex plumbing systems or chemical handling processes may rely on backflow prevention to protect public health and meet regulatory standards.

Installation Costs - The cost for installing a backflow preventer typically ranges from $150 to $400, depending on the system type and complexity. For example, a basic model in Herndon, VA, might cost around $200, while more advanced setups could reach $350 or more.
Material Expenses - The price of backflow preventer units generally falls between $50 and $200. Simple devices are usually on the lower end, whereas specialized or commercial-grade models tend to be more expensive.
Labor Charges - Labor costs for installation services can vary from $100 to $300, influenced by system complexity and local rates. In some cases, additional plumbing work may increase the overall labor expense.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ses such as permits, site preparation, or system modifications can add $50 to $150. These costs depend on local regulations and the specific requirements of the installation site.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
